John is an ex-gambler who attempts to start anew by working for an insurance company in beautifully mundane Albuquerque. On the same day that John strikes up an amorous relationship with smiley face-obsessed co-worker, Jill, he receives a promotion to Fraud Investigator.  John must now put his budding love life on hold to shadow Virgil, the maverick superstar of Townsend Insurance.  Together, the unlikely pair travel through the outskirts of Las Vegas investigating a claim by a wheelchair-bound stripper seeking…
